Colonel Eric Tauch, a native of Texas, commissioned in
the US Army in May 1992, upon graduation from the United States Military
Academy, West Point, New York.
During his 23+ years of commissioned service, Colonel
Tauch held command and staff assignments in Korea, Colorado, Hawaii, Utah,
Washington, DC, California, and Virginia.
He deployed in support of INTRINSIC ACTION in Kuwait and Iraq, and
Operation STABILIZE in East Timor. He
also served as the Officer in Charge (OIC) for the Defense Intelligence
Agency’s Libya Task Force supporting Operation ODYSSEY DAWN.
Command and staff highlights include: Ground Section OIC
and CINC Command Intelligence Briefer, United States Forces Korea (USFK) J2;
Assistant Battalion S2, 3-68 Armor Battalion, 4th Infantry Division; Battalion
S-2, 1-12 Infantry Battalion, 4th Infantry Division; Analysis and Control
Element (ACE) Operations Officer and Command Intelligence Briefer, US Army
Pacific (USARPAC); Company Commander, Bravo Company (CI), 205th Military
Intelligence Battalion, 500th Military Intelligence Brigade; US Forces J2, East
Timor; Battalion S3, 3-360th Training Support Battalion, 91st Training Support
Division; G3/7 Operations Officer, 9th Mission Support Command; Chief of
Operations, Joint Reserve Intelligence Program, Defense Intelligence Agency;
Commander, Western Army Reserve Intelligence Support Center; G3/7 Chief of
Training, Military Intelligence Readiness Command; and G3/5/7 Director of
Operations, Plans & Training, Military Intelligence Readiness Command. He assumed his current role as the Deputy
Commanding Officer, Military Intelligence Readiness Command, in January 2016.
Colonel Tauch holds a Bachelor of Science Degree in
Management from the United States Military Academy, and a Master of Science in
National Resource Strategy from the Dwight D. Eisenhower School for National
Security and Resource Strategy. He is a
graduate of the Military Intelligence Officers’ Basic and Advanced Courses; the
Counterintelligence Agent Course; Combined Arms and Services Staff School, and
Intermediate Level Education.
Awards and decorations include: Defense Meritorious Service Medal, Meritorious
Service Medal with four oak leaf clusters, Army Commendation Medal with two oak
leaf clusters, and Army Achievement Medal with three oak leaf clusters. He is Airborne qualified and a recipient of
the Knowlton Award.
Colonel Tauch is married to Lieutenant Colonel Kimberly
Tauch of Hawaii. They have three
children.
